The Getback

USA 2023
produced by
Demetrius Stear, Jubal Ace Kohn (executive), Jared Cohn (executive), Carolina Brasil (executive), Michelle Schwarzer (executive), Daniel Figueiredo (executive), Ryan Francis (executive), Richard Switzer (executive), Ian Niles (executive), Chad Law (executive), Jordan Dykstra (executive), Ellen Wander (executive), Javier C. Ortiz (executive) for Mutiny Films/Tubi
directed by Jared Cohn
starring Theo Rossi, Shane Paul McGhie, Dermot Mulroney, Sufe Bradshaw, Kim Coates, Anthony 'Treach' Criss, Ritchie Montgomery, Ryan Francis, Sarah Voigt, Jessica Harthcock, JC Anthony, Canesha Bea, Mark Valeriano, Justtone Jackson, Summer Selby, Laura Linn, Laith Wallschleger, Jesse O'Neill, Erin O'Brien, Sean Richmond, Thadd Turner, Wyatt Turner, Holly Bonney, Emme Daigle, Tedrick Martin, River McCollum, Brianna Abrams
written by Chad Law, Garry Charles, music by Daniel Figueiredo

review by
Mike Haberfelner

Mal Cooper (Theo Rossi), a disgraced cop turned bounty hunter, is to bring in Jake Gordon (Shane Paul McGhie), key witness in a trial against cop killer Beaumont (Anthony 'Treach' Criss), who has gotten cold feet and now tries to skip country. For a bounty hunter of Cooper's caliber it's no problem to track down Gordon, but it turns out to be much harder to convince him to come back with him, especially since Gordon carries a bag full of money with him. But when an attempt on Gordon's life is made and Cooper shoots it out with the assassin, Gordon begins to understand that Cooper is on his side. During their drive into town, Cooper and Gordon run into many an ambush, as apparently somebody has put out an open hit on Gordon, but Cooper sure isn't one to let his guard down. But then he receives news that let his heart sink: Turns out Cooper isn't witness of the prosecution but of the defense, as he's a witness that it wasn't Beaumont who killed two cops but another cop - a cop from Cooper's former precinct. Now that's doubly troubling for Cooper, as for one many of his friends still work at the precinct, and since one of the few people who know about his whereabouts is his former colleague Hatch (Sufe Bradshaw), there must be a leak somewhere in the precinct - which will make bringing Gordon back to town and to the court all the more difficult ...

Veterans Dermot Mulroney and Kim Coates play the chief of police and Cooper's sleazy boss, respectively.

 

In story this is certainly a throwback to buddy action comedies from the 1980s, as it's packed with all the right ingredients. In execution however, The Getback feels very fresh, a very well executed B-movie that doesn't tryo to overreach in ambition but tells its story in a swift way, is fast enough paced to keep the audience on the edges of their seats, features some well-executed setpieces, and even finds its heart in some of the quieter scenes without distracting from the main story. And a solid cast carry everything rather beautifully, making this pretty cool action entertainment.
